ABOUT THE LABOR COUNCIL
The 200,000 working families of the San Diego and Imperial Counties Labor Council improve the lives of all ,working people by standing together and fighting for each other. Our members come from a broad array of sectors and professions. We are nurses, teachers, firefighters, retail workers, truck drivers, construction tradespeople, grocery employees, domestic workers, janitors, stagehands, college professors, and more.
OUR MISSION
Rebuilding the Middle Class Together.
We fight to ensure every worker has a voice on the job and at the negotiating table. With that voice, we stand up to our bosses to secure better wages, healthcare, retirement security, and fair treatment.
But our power doesn’t stop there. We bring our collective strength into the halls of government, where union workers are a formidable force for change. We work tirelessly to make housing more affordable, improve education, and lower healthcare costs. We demand justice, dignity, and equality for every
working family.
Our community—comprising workers, delegates, e-board members, and staff—empowers workers daily. Together, we sign quality contracts, elect pro-worker leaders, and pass laws that prioritize the needs of workers.

LABOR COUNCIL DELEGATES
Delegates are the worker leaders that make up the Labor Council’s ultimate decision making body. They attend monthly meetings as representatives of their local unions.
Voting on everything from the leadership of our organization and our annual budget to the candidates and policies we endorse, they are the voice of workers in our “union of unions”.
